When calculating square footage, you multiply the length by the width of a room or area to determine its total area in square feet. However, when using inches, this process becomes a bit more complex. One square foot is equal to 144 square inches (12 inches x 12 inches). To convert square footage to inches, you need to take into account this calculation.

For example, if a room is 12 feet by 10 feet, its total square footage would be 120 square feet. To convert this to inches, you multiply 120 square feet by 144 square inches per square foot, resulting in 17,280 square inches.

What is the Difference Between Square Footage and Square Inches?
Yes, there are online calculators and apps that can aid in converting square footage to square inches and vice versa. You can also use spreadsheet software to do the conversion for you.
